Conversion formula
The conversion factor from grams to pounds is 0.0022046226218488, which means that 1 gram is equal to 0.0022046226218488 pounds:
1 g = 0.0022046226218488 lb
To convert 426 grams into pounds we have to multiply 426 by the conversion factor in order to get the mass amount from grams to pounds.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 g → 0.0022046226218488 lb
426 g → M(lb)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the mass M in pounds:
M(lb) = 426 g × 0.0022046226218488 lb
M(lb) = 0.93916923690758 lb
The final result is:
426 g → 0.93916923690758 lb
We conclude that 426 grams is equivalent to 0.93916923690758 pounds:
426 grams = 0.93916923690758 pounds
